在R中,可以使用for循环来遍历向量并添加新变量。for循环是一种控制流程结构,可以重复执行特定的代码块,直到满足特定条件为止。
以下是一个示例代码,演示如何使用for循环在向量中添加新变量:
# 创建一个向量
my_vector <- c(1, 2, 3, 4, 5)
# 创建一个空的新变量
new_variable <- NULL
# 使用for循环遍历向量并添加新变量
for (i in my_vector) {
new_value <- i * 2 # 这里可以根据需要进行相应的计算或操作
new_variable <- c(new_variable, new_value) # 将新值添加到新变量中
}
# 打印新变量
print(new_variable)
在上述示例中,我们首先创建了一个名为my_vector
的向量,然后创建了一个空的新变量new_variable
。接下来,使用for循环遍历my_vector
中的每个元素,并根据需要进行相应的计算或操作,将新值添加到new_variable
中。最后,打印出新变量的值。
这个方法可以用于各种情况,例如对向量中的元素进行转换、筛选、计算等操作,并将结果存储在新变量中。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云